#be6ee3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#be6ee3 is composed of 74.5% red, 43.1%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.3% cyan, 51.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 281 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 66.1%. #be6ee3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#7d00c7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#be6ee3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f9f2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#be6ee3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a3ae is the less saturated color, while #c853fe is the most saturated one.
